What companies run services between Benidorm, Spain and Turin, Italy?

Ryanair and Vueling Airlines fly from Alicante-Elche Airport (ALC) to Turin Caselle Airport (TRN) 5 times a week.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Benidorm to Turin via Lyon in around 21h 12m.
